NAME OF WORK:- Str. Improvement & Rehabilitation of Katra Dwellers. SUB-HEAD:- Str. Improvement of DUSIB Katra No.919/X Kucha Rohilla Tirha Behram Khan (PID No. 13529)
Sl. No. Item Description
1Demolishing cement concrete manually/ by mechanical means includingdisposal of material within 50 metre lead as per direction of Engineer- in- charge : Nominal concrete 1:3:6 or richer mix (i/c equivalent design mix)
2Demolishing cement concrete manually/ by mechanical means includingdisposal of material within 50 metre lead as per direction of Engineer- in- charge :Nominal concrete 1:4:8 or leaner mix (i/c equivalent design mix)
3Demolishing brick work manually/ by mechanical means including stacking of serviceable material and disposal of unserviceable material within 50 metres lead as per direction of Engineer- in- charge. In lime mortar with old mughal bricks
4Demolishing brick work manually/ by mechanical means including stacking of serviceable material and disposal of unserviceable material within 50 metres lead as per direction of Engineer- in- charge. In cement mortar
5Removing mortar from bricks and cleaning bricks including stacking within a lead of 50 m (stacks of cleaned bricks shall be measured) :From brick work in cement mortar
6Dismantling wood work in frames, trusses, purlins and rafters up to 10 metres span and 5 metres height including stacking the material within 50 metres lead : Of sectional area 40 square centimetres and above
7Dismantling steel work in single sections including dismembering and stacking within 50 metres lead in: Channels, angles, tees and flats
8Dismantling stone slab roofing over wooden karries or R.C.C. battens (dismantling karries and battens to be paid for separately), including stacking of serviceable material and disposal of unserviceable material within 50 metres lead.
9Dismantling doors, windows and clerestory windows (steel or wood) shutter including chowkhats, architrave, holdfasts etc. complete and stacking within 50 metres lead : Of area 3 sq. metres and below
10Dismantling old plaster or skirting raking out joints and cleaning the surface for plaster including disposal of rubbish to the dumping ground within 50 metres lead
11Brick work with common burnt clay F.P.S. (non modular) bricks of class designation 7.5 in superstructure above plinth level up to floor V level in all shapes and sizes in : Cement mortar 1:6(1 cement : 6 coarse sand)(Bricks shall be suplied by department free of cost at site of work
12Brick work with common burnt clay F.P.S. (non modular) bricks of class designation 7.5 in superstructure above plinth level up to floor V level in all shapes and sizes in :Cement mortar 1:6 (1 cement : 6 coarse sand)
13Half brick masonry with common burnt clay F.P.S. (non modular) bricks of class designation 7.5 in superstructure above plinth level up to floor V Cement mortar 1:4 (1 cement :4 coarse sand)
14Structural steel work in single section, fixed with or without connecting plate, including cutting, hoisting, fixing in position and applying a priming coat of approved steel primer all complete.
15Providing and fixing 1mm thick M.S. sheet door with frame of 40x40x6 mm angle iron and 3 mm M.S. gusset plates at the junctions and corners, all necessary fittings complete, including applying a priming coat of approved steel primer. Using flats 30x6mm for diagonal braces and central cross piece
16Providing and fixing T-iron frames for doors, windows and ventilators of mild steel Tee-sections, joints mitred and welded, including fixing of necessary butt hinges and screws and applying a priming coat of approved steel primer. Fixing with 15x3 mm lugs 10 cm long embedded in cement concrete block 15x10x10 cm of C.C. 1:3:6 (1 Cement : 3 coarse sand : 6 graded stone aggregate 20 mm nominal size)
17Providing sand stone slab for roofing and laying them in cement mortar 1 : 4 (1 cement : 4 coarse sand) over wooden karries or R.C.C.battens or structural steel sections (Karries or battens or structural steel sections to be paid separately), including pointing the ceiling joints with cement mortar 1:3 (1 cement : 3 fine sand ) complete : Red sand stone slab 40 to 50 mmthick
18Laying slabs of all thickness for roofing in cement mortar 1:4 (1 cement : 4 coarse sand) over wooden karries or RS Joists/T-iron(karries and RS Joists/T-iron to be paid for separately) including pointing the ceiling joints with cement mortar 1:3 (1 cement : 3 fine sand ). Stone slabs shall be provided by the department free of cost at site of work.
19Cement concrete flooring 1:2:4 (1 cement : 2 coarse sand : 4 graded stone aggregate) finished with a floating coat of neat cement, including cement slurry, but excluding the cost of nosing of steps etc. complete. 40 mm thick with 20 mm nominal size stone aggregate
20Neat cement punning
21Providing and fixing Ist quality ceramic glazed wall tiles conforming to IS: 15622 (thickness to be specified by the manufacturer), of approved make,in all colours, shades except burgundy, bottle green, black of any size as approved by Engineer-in-Charge, in skirting, risers of steps and dados, over 12 mm thick bed of cement mortar 1:3 (1 cement : 3 coarse sand) and jointing with grey cement slurry @ 3.3kg per sqm, including pointing in white cement mixed with pigment of matching shade complete
22Providing and laying rectified Glazed Ceramic floor tiles of size 300x300 mm or more (thickness to be specified by the manufacturer), of 1st quality conforming to IS : 15622, of approved make, in colours White, Ivory, Grey, Fume Red Brown, laid on 20 mm thick cement mortar 1:4 (1 Cement: 4 Coarse sand), including grouting the joints with white cement and matching pigments etc., complete
23Providing gola 75x75 mm in cement concrete 1:2:4 (1 cement : 2 coarse sand : 4 stone aggregate 10 mm and down gauge), including finishing with cement mortar 1:3 (1 cement : 3 fine sand) as per standard design :In 75x75 mm deep chase metre
24Making khurras 45x45 cm with average minimum thickness of 5 cm cement concrete 1:2:4 (1 cement : 2 coarse sand : 4 graded stone aggregate of 20 mm nominal size) over P.V.C. sheet 1 m x1 m x 400 micron, finished with 12 mm cement plaster 1:3 (1 cement : 3 coarse sand) and a coat of neat cement, rounding the edges and making and finishing the outlet complete.
2512 mm cement plaster of mix: 1:6 (1 cement : 6 fine sand)
2615 mm cement plaster on the rough side of single or half brickwall of mix: 1:6 (1 cement : 6 fine sand)
27Providing and fixing water closet squatting pan (Indian type W.C. pan ) with 100 mm sand cast Iron P or S trap, 10 litre low level white P.V.C. flushing cistern, including flush pipe, with manually controlled device (handle lever) conforming to IS : 7231, with all fittings and fixtures complete, including cutting and making good the walls and floors wherever required: White Vitreous china Orissa pattern W.C. pan of size 580x440 mm with integral type foot rests
28Deduct for not providing hinges in doors, windows or clerestory window shutters with : ISI marked M.S. pressed butt hinges bright finished of required size For 2nd class teak wood and other class of wood shutters
29Providing and fixing aluminium tower bolts ISI marked anodised ( anodic coating not less than grade AC 10 as per IS : 1868 ) transparent or dyed to required colour or shade with nuts and screws etc. complete : 150 X 10 mm
30Providing and fixing aluminium pull bolt lock, ISI marked, anodised (anodic coating not less than grade AC 10 as per IS : 1868) transparent or dyed of required colour and shade, with necessary screws bolts, nut and washers etc. complete.
31Providing and fixing aluminium handles ISI marked anodised (anodic coating not less than grade AC 10 as per IS : 1868 ) transparent or dyed to required colour or shade with necessary screws etc. complete : 100 mm
3230 mm thick Glass Fibre Reinforced Plastic (FRP) panelled door shutter of required colour and approved brand and manufacture, made with fire - retardant grade unsaturated polyester resin, moulded to 3 mm thick FRP laminate for forming hollow rails and styles, with wooden frame and suitable blocks of seasoned wood inside at required places for fixing of fittings, cast monolithically with 5 mm thick FRP laminate for panels conforming to IS: 14856, including fixing to frames.
33Providing and fixing soil, waste and vent pipes 100 mm dia. Sand cast iron S & S pipe as per IS: 1729
34Providing and filling the joints with spun yarn cement, slurry andcement mortar 1:2 ( 1 cement: 2 fine sand) in S.C.I/C.I pipes 100 mm dia pipe
35Providing and fixing M.S. holder bat clamps of approved design to sand cast iron / cast iron ( spun ) pipe embedded in and including cement concrete blocks 10 X 10 X 10 cm of 1:2:4 ( 1 Cement : 2 Coarse Sand : 4 graded stone aggregate 20mm nominal size ) including cost of cutting holes and making good the walls for 100 mm dia pipe
36Providing and fixing plain bend of required degree 100 mm Sand cast iron S&S as per IS-1729
37Providing and fixing PTMT bib cock of approved quality and colour. 15mm nominal bore, 86 mm long, weighing not less than 88 gms
38Providing and fixing PTMT stop cock of approved quality and colour. 20 ‘mm nominal bore, 89 mm long, weighing not less than88 gms
39Providing and placing on terrace (at all floor levels) polyethylene water storage tank, ISI : 12701 marked, with cover and suitable locking arrangement and making necessary holes for inlet, outlet and overflow pipes but without fittings and the base support for tank.Circulsr Tank
40Earth work in excavation by mechanical means (Hydraulic excavator) / manual means in foundation trenches or drains (not exceeding 1.5 m in width or 10 sqm on plan), including dressing of sides and ramming of bottoms, lift upto 1.5 m, including getting out the excavated soil and disposal of surplus excavated soil as directed, within a lead of 50 m. All kinds of soil.
41Providing and laying in position cement concrete of specified grade excluding the cost of centering and shuttering - All work up to plinth level :1:5:10 (1 cement : 5 coarse sand (zone-III): 10 graded stone aggregate 40 mm nominal size).
42Brick work with common burnt clay F.P.S. (non modular) bricks of class designation 7.5 in foundation and plinth in:Cement mortar 1:6 (1 cement : 6 coarse sand)
43Breaking available brick bats at site into bricks aggregate of 40 mm nominal size including stacking and laying dry brick aggregate 40mm nominal size ubder olinth floor at all levels including sepreading consolidating by sprinkling water to required level as directed by Engineer in charge
44Making connection of drain or sewer line with existing manhole including breaking into and making good the walls, floors with cement concrete 1:2:4 mix (1 cement : 2 coarse sand : 4 graded stone aggregate 20 mm nominal size) cement plastered on both sides with cement mortar 1:3 (1 cement : 3 coarse sand), finished with a floating coat of neat cement and making necessary channels for the drain etc. complete : For pipes 250 to 300 mm diameter
45Disposal of building rubbish / malba/ similar unserviceable, dismantled or waste materials by mechanical means, including loading, transporting, unloading to approved municipal dumping ground or as approved by Engineer-in-charge, beyond 50 m initial lead, for all leads including all lifts involved.
46Extra for every additional lead of 50m or part thereof beyond first 50m upto 9 such additional leads Lime, moorum building rubbish (44.88x9)
47Deduct for not Providing and fixing P.V.C. low level flushing cistern with manually controlled device (handle lever) conforming to IS : 7231, with all fittings and fixturescomplete.10 litre capacity - White
